**NEW FOR 2020 WINTER CLASSIC**

The winner of each Free Skate event from STAR 5 to Gold at the 2020 Winter Classic will be crowned the 2020 STAR Champion of Saskatchewan in their respective event. Winners will be presented a keeper plaque in addition to their medal. These Free Skate events will not be divided into flights regardless of the number of entries. Where applicable, categories will be divided into separate events by age (e.g. STAR 5 U10, U13, and 13&O).

Coaches List - updated January 22nd, 2020

Coaches must be a minimum of Regional Coach Certified and must be a current professional coaching member of Skate Canada in good standing.

If you are not at the NCCP certification level required, you must receive permission from the Section Office. All requests (emailed to [email protected]) must be received on or before 12:00 PM (Noon) CST on Friday, February 14th, 2020.

If you are not list on the coaches’ list above, please contact the Section Office at [email protected] to receive accreditation for Winter Classic on or before 12:00 PM (Noon) CST on Friday, February 14th, 2020.

Please remember to bring your coach accreditation tag issued at Sask Skate or Sectionals.  If you require a coach accreditation tag, please contact the Section Office at [email protected] on or before 12:00 PM (Noon) CST on Friday, February 14th, 2020.  No accrecitation will be issued on-site.

Coaches must register in person at the competition venue.
